Coinbase CEO Fires Engineers Refusing AI Tools Amid Adoption Push
Coinbase CEO Brian Armstrong has mandated the adoption of AI coding tools like GitHub Copilot and Cursor among the company's engineers, emphasizing the critical importance of AI integration for future operations. After acquiring enterprise licenses, Armstrong set a strict one-week deadline for all engineers to onboard these tools, with non-compliance resulting in termination, a decision he described as "heavy-handed" but necessary to convey the urgency of AI adoption. Some employees who failed to comply without valid reasons were fired following a company-wide meeting Armstrong held to address the issue. Since the mandate, Coinbase has increased AI training efforts and now reports that around one-third of its code is written by AI, reflecting the company's deepening reliance on these technologies. Armstrong's stance mirrors a broader tech industry trend where AI is viewed as essential for efficiency and innovation, with other CEOs warning that resistance to AI could jeopardize jobs. Despite the benefits, there remain concerns about managing AI-generated code and workforce impacts, highlighting ongoing challenges in integrating AI tools effectively.
